How did the creation of the nation of israel increase tension in the subregion?

The creation of the nation of Israel in 1948 heightened tensions in the subregion primarily due to the displacement of Palestinian Arabs, leading to a significant refugee crisis and feelings of disenfranchisement among Palestinians. The establishment of a Jewish state in a predominantly Arab region incited conflict between Jewish and Arab communities, culminating in wars and ongoing disputes over land and sovereignty. Additionally, neighboring Arab states opposed Israel's creation, resulting in a series of military confrontations and a lasting geopolitical divide that continues to affect relations in the Middle East.

What scheming princess of tire married and manipulated the weak ahab and imposed her pagan religion on israel?

The scheming princess of Tyre who married and manipulated the weak Ahab and imposed her pagan religion on Israel was Jezebel. Jezebel was a Phoenician princess who married King Ahab of Israel and introduced the worship of Baal, a Canaanite god, to the Israelites. Her actions led to significant religious and political turmoil in Israel during the 9th century BCE.

Does the zi in nazi stand for zionist?

No, the "zi" in Nazi does not stand for Zionist. The term "Nazi" is a shortened form of the German word "Nationalsozialist," which translates to National Socialist in English. The Nazi party, led by Adolf Hitler, was a far-right political party in Germany that promoted extreme nationalism and anti-Semitism, among other ideologies. The term "Zionist" refers to a movement advocating for the establishment of a Jewish homeland in Israel.

Where is Bethlehem on the world map?

Bethlehem is located in the West Bank region of the Middle East, specifically in the Palestinian territories. It is situated about 10 kilometers south of Jerusalem and is a significant historical and cultural site for Christians as the birthplace of Jesus Christ.
